How to overlay a design template onto an existing pdf
- Step 1Export the template as a single-page PDF — Create a single-page template in your design tool with transparent content areas where the document text will show through.
- Step 2Upload the content PDF — Drop the document to be branded into the stamp tool.
- Step 3Upload the template as the overlay — Add the template PDF or PNG as the stamp layer.
- Step 4Apply to all pages and download — Overlay on every page and save the branded output.

The template blocks my document content — what do I do?+
Ensure the content area of the template is transparent. Set the z-order so the template renders behind existing page content, or design the template with a frame-only layout.
Can I use different templates for different page ranges?+
Apply the stamp in separate passes — one template for pages 1-2, a different template for the remaining pages.
Will the overlaid template affect PDF file size significantly?+
Embedding a template image on every page does increase file size. Compress the output using the PDF Compress tool to minimise the increase.
